The property

Keswick 4.3 miles.

Westerlodge is a charming single-storey property located in Threlkeld, Cumbria, surrounded by the beauty of the Lake District.

Inside, you’ll find a welcoming sitting room with a woodburning stove, a well-equipped kitchen, and a separate dining room, creating a sociable space for family meals.

Three bedrooms provide flexibility for different party makeups, while the outdoor area invites you to soak up the tranquil views.

Explore Keswick for lakeside walks and cultural attractions, discover Grasmere’s literary heritage, or enjoy Ambleside’s bustling streets and access to Lake Windermere.

Westerlodge is a fantastic choice for those seeking relaxation and adventure in equal measure.

About the location

KESWICK

Bassenthwaite 7 miles, Ullswater 16.6 miles; Cockermouth 13 miles.

The popular town of Keswick is the holiday centre of the North of the Lake District and has plenty to offer the visitor at any time of year. The town boasts numerous shops and restaurants to suit all tastes, as well as offering miniature golf, excellent parks, the famous Theatre by the Lake, a charming cinema, the Pencil Museum, a climbing wall, fishing and great mountain biking opportunities, whilst the beautiful lake of Derwentwater at the head of the stunning Borrowdale Valley is only a few minutes walk from the town centre. Nearby, between Braithwaite and Buttermere is the beautiful Newlands Valley, while picturesque Bassenthwaite Lake is well worth a visit. From a gentle countryside ramble to a challenging hike up Skiddaw or the famous Catbells, there really is something for everyone. Visit Castlerigg Stone Circle, the Jennings Brewery and Mirehouse, a grand house and gardens on the shores of the Bassenthwaite Lake, or take a fabulous boat trip around Derwentwater. With plenty of attractions for the kids, lovely parks and the nearby Lake District Wildlife Park this is a great Lakeland destination whatever the time of year.
